pytest-dashboard
usage
python -m pytest
by this command, you get [datetime]-progress.yaml
file on working directory as realtime pytest progress report.
python -m pytest --progress-path=[path/to/some-progress.yaml]
by this command, you get path/to/some-progress.yaml
file.
python -m pytest-dashboard.tolly PROGRESSES_DIR --entire_progress_path=[path/to/entire-progress.yaml]
by this command, you get started to monitor changes of
the progress files (ends with -progress.yaml
)
inside PROGRESS_DIR
and save the state summary
to path/to/entire-progress.yaml
.
So it is recommended to set --progress-path
option of pytest
ending with -progress.yaml
.
For example, 2024-04-22-progress.yaml
,
Note if your
entire_progress_path
is ends with-progress.yaml
, you cannot save the entire progress file to the same directory with each progress file.
python -m pytest_dashboard.tolly --progress-dir=[dir/contains/progress.yaml_files]
by this command, you monitor -progress.yaml files
inside dir/contains/progress.yaml_files
and continurous update to tolly them
to --entire-progress-path
(optional, default to entire-progress.yaml
) file.
